Actual full name PEARLIE PAULINE RAYBOURN, but always went by Pauline. Eldest child of Andrew A. Raybourn (1900-1970) and Cola A. (Rutland) Raybourn (1903-1965) [both buried at Good Hope Church Cemetery outside Columbia, MS] Sister Reda Mae Ward (1926-2004), brother Howard Raybourn (1930-1984), and brother Dan Raybourn of Laurel, Ms. (deceased siblings linked under parents).

She was a very devout Christian lady and member of Kingston Assembly of God Church. As the tomestone inscription reads, she was truly "A Good Sister and a Great Aunt."

Special Note: Though they were never officially married, Pauline Raybourn and Charles Myrick maintained a special friendship during the last decades of their lives. This special friendship is certainly deserving of their being linked on this site.
